| CVE-2026-6469 | 1 Postgresql | 1 Postgresql | 2026-08-13 | 3.8 Low |
| Incorrect ownership assignment in PostgreSQL ALTER TABLE ALTER TYPE command reassigns ownership of dependent statistics objects to the current user. This wrongly allows the table owner to run DROP STATISTICS and ALTER STATISTICS via this improper ownership. It wrongly denies those commands to the prior statistics object owner. DROP TABLE remains able to remove statistics objects, so this exploit achieves nothing in many ownership arrangements. Versions before PostgreSQL 18.5, 17.11, 16.15, 15.19, and 14.24 are affected. | ||||
| CVE-2026-6464 | 1 Postgresql | 1 Postgresql | 2026-08-13 | 8.1 High |
| Untrusted data inclusion in PostgreSQL psql COPY may allow a server administrator to elicit execution of data lines as psql commands, via error injection. If the "COPY FROM STDIN" or "\copy FROM STDIN" command fails before the server indicates that it awaits input rows, psql processes the in-line data rows as psql commands. "COPY FROM" with a filename is unaffected. The server administrator has no inherent control over the data rows, so a complete attack requires the attacker to separately acquire control of both the server and the data rows. Alternatively, an attacker controlling data rows alone might complete an attack through a coincidental error that they don't control. Versions before PostgreSQL 18.5, 17.11, 16.15, 15.19, and 14.24 are affected. | ||||

| CVE-2026-66878 | 1 Redhat | 2 Acm, Advanced Cluster Management For Kubernetes | 2026-08-13 | 7.7 High |
| A flaw was found in multicloud-operators-subscription. A privileged user, specifically a namespace administrator capable of creating Channel and Subscription resources, can exploit this vulnerability. By manipulating the Channel.Spec.SecretRef.Namespace field, the user can cause the system to copy sensitive Secret contents from other namespaces into their own, leading to information disclosure. | ||||
